What Defines a Reliable Hot Stamping Foil Partner for Textiles

A reliable hot stamping foil partner for textiles understands that the material is only half the equation. They test how foil releases onto cotton, polyester, blends, knits, and coated fabrics, adjusting topcoats and adhesive layers so that fine details survive washing, stretching, and abrasion. Color consistency across production lots is not a promise but a measurable habit—each batch is checked against a master standard before it leaves the warehouse.

Beyond the roll, the right partner offers real technical support. They ask about your press settings, fabric construction, and end use, then recommend specific foils for low-temperature application or high-speed runs. When a new fabric finish appears mid-season, they can supply a modified foil within days, not weeks, and they keep detailed records so reorders match earlier shades without drift.

Practical reliability also shows up in inventory management. A solid partner stocks enough base film and pigments to handle sudden demand spikes, and they give honest lead times instead of optimistic guesses. They will tell you when a particular metallic shade is prone to supply issues and suggest a close alternative before you commit to a production schedule. This kind of transparency turns a material supplier into a production safeguard.

Why Premium Textile Finishes Demand Specific Foil Formulations

Best Fabric Hot Stamping Foil Manufacturer

Premium textile finishing isn't just about adding a metallic sheen—the foil has to endure repeated flexing, washing, and dry cleaning without cracking or peeling. Generic foils typically rely on cheaper resins and coarser metal particles, which adhere poorly to high-thread-count or coated fabrics. A specific formulation adjusts binder elasticity, pigment load, and particle size so the finish stays intact even on stretch panels or densely woven textiles.

The substrate itself often dictates the need for a custom foil. Many luxury fabrics carry silicone finishes, water repellents, or softeners that interfere with standard adhesive layers. Foils engineered for premium use incorporate modified urethane or acrylic binders that bond to those treated surfaces without demanding harsh curing temperatures that could weaken delicate fibers.

Finally, color depth and reflective quality depend heavily on the foil's chemistry. In high-end garments, the foil leaf must deliver consistent opacity and brightness across large areas and intricate motifs. Off-the-shelf options frequently show dull patches or uneven transfer on textured weaves, whereas a tailored formulation ensures clean release and sharp edge definition, giving the finished piece a more refined, durable luster.

The Real Difference Between Standard and High-End Fabric Foils

The most obvious giveaway sits in the adhesive layer. Standard fabric foil uses a single-pass heat-activated glue that grips the surface but rarely survives repeated stretching or a true machine wash. High-end versions rely on a two-stage bonding system, often with a polyurethane-based carrier, so the metallic finish flexes with the fabric instead of cracking into a spiderweb after the third wear.

Color density is another fast tell. Budget foils lean on a thin aluminum deposition, which gives that slightly grey, washed-out shimmer under daylight and turns brassy after exposure to sweat or humidity. Premium foils stack multiple micro-layers of pigment and reflective particles, keeping the tone saturated even when you bend the material. You'll notice the difference when you compare a scrap piece side by side: the cheap sheet looks almost translucent at the edges, while the good one holds a solid, mirror-like edge.

Application behavior also separates them. Standard foil demands a narrow temperature window and forgiving pressure; go a few degrees over and it turns dull or sticks to the carrier. High-end foil tolerates a wider heat range and releases cleanly from the backing, which means you can work with textured fabrics, dense knits, or layered designs without constant re-pressing. It's less about the price tag and more about how the foil behaves once it leaves the roll.

How Custom Foil Colors and Patterns Elevate Fabric Design

There is a moment in every design process when a fabric sample moves from ordinary to unforgettable. Often, that shift happens the first time light catches a custom foil finish. A deep navy linen with copper foil scattered like broken constellations reads differently at noon than it does under evening lamps. The foil does not sit on the surface; it changes the way the eye travels across the weave, pulling attention toward the texture underneath. Designers use this to their advantage when they want a single upholstered chair or jacket lapel to anchor an entire room or outfit without shouting.

Patterns take that effect further. Instead of stamping a generic metallic motif over any base cloth, custom work lets the foil follow the fabric's own rhythm. A herringbone wool might receive fine gold lines only along its diagonal ridges, making the structure feel carved rather than printed. Floral jacquards can pick up silver in the folds of petals, giving the blossoms a soft, lit-from-within quality that flat inks cannot match. Because every color is mixed for a specific run, there is no need to settle for stock champagne or bright gold. The palette can drift toward oxidized bronze, rose pewter, or even a green-gold that echoes aged glass.

Ultimately, custom foil colors and patterns do more than decorate. They create a second layer of narrative within the cloth itself. A designer might choose a muted sage ground with antique brass dots to suggest a garden after rain, or pair indigo denim with erratic silver veining for a mood borrowed from storm maps. Those choices are not random; they come from understanding how metallic reflection interacts with dye, weave, and light throughout the day. When the finish is tailored this way, fabric stops being a background material and starts behaving like a signature, one that other elements in a collection quietly refer back to.

Troubleshooting Common Hot Stamping Challenges on Fabric

When foil only partially transfers, the first thing to check is heat. Cotton and linen absorb more heat than polyester, so the same setting that works on a blend may barely activate the adhesive on a thick canvas. Run a small test strip before committing to the final piece, and nudge the temperature up by three to five degrees at a time until the edges turn crisp without any scorch mark. If the fabric starts to glaze or stiffen, you have gone too far.

Uneven pressure causes more failed stampings than most people realize, especially on textured weaves or near seams. A dense embroidery or a thick hem can lift one side of the platen just enough to starve the foil of contact. Use a silicone pad with a bit of give, and consider adding a thin shim under the lower-pressure area to even things out. For deeply textured fabric, increase dwell time slightly rather than cranking up the force, which can crush the pile.

Poor wash fastness usually points to surface finishes or a mismatched foil. New fabric often carries sizing agents that block adhesion, so a quick pre-wash and dry makes a noticeable difference. Choose a foil rated for textiles rather than one meant for paper or leather. After pressing, let the carrier cool completely before peeling it away; peeling too soon can tear the metallic layer at the edges. If the design still flakes after a few washes, dust a fine layer of hot-melt adhesive powder over the area before pressing to anchor the foil into the fibers.

FAQ

What makes hot stamping foil suitable for premium textile finishes?

The foil's release layer and adhesive compatibility are tuned for fabric fibers, allowing crisp metallic or holographic impressions without cracking or peeling. Premium foils use finer pigment particles and a more flexible resin system, so the finish stays intact even when the fabric stretches or drapes.

How do I choose a reliable fabric hot stamping foil manufacturer?

Look for makers who share detailed technical datasheets, offer sample rolls before bulk orders, and have experience with the exact fabric blends you use. A dependable supplier will also ask about your stamping machine's temperature range and pressure settings rather than pushing a one-size-fits-all product.

Which fabrics work best with hot stamping foil?

Tightly woven natural or synthetic fabrics like cotton sateen, polyester satin, nylon taffeta, and blended twill hold foil well because their smooth surface gives the adhesive a strong grip. Loosely knitted or heavily textured fabrics can still be foiled but usually need a primer or lower stretch expectations.

Can hot stamping foil withstand repeated washing and dry cleaning?

Yes, if you choose a foil rated for laundering and follow the correct curing time and temperature. Many premium foils pass 30 to 50 home wash cycles or multiple dry clean cycles without significant loss of shine, though abrasion from zippers or rough seams can accelerate wear.

What customization options are available for textile hot stamping foil?

Beyond standard gold and silver, manufacturers can match custom Pantone shades, create matte, glossy, rainbow, pearl, or laser holographic effects, and adjust the foil's release temperature for your specific fabric and machine. Widths, roll lengths, and core sizes are usually flexible as well.

How does hot stamping foil compare to other textile embellishment methods?

Foil stamping gives a flatter, mirror-like metallic finish that screen printing or embroidery cannot achieve, and it requires no water or solvents. However, it is best for smooth areas and moderate flex, whereas embroidery handles heavy wear and deep textures better. Many designers combine foil with other techniques for layered effects.

What technical specifications should I look for in high-quality stamping foil?

Check the foil's recommended stamping temperature (often 100–160°C for fabrics), dwell time, and pressure range. Also look for elongation percentage—premium textile foils can stretch 10–30% before cracking. A detailed substrate compatibility list and storage stability notes are signs of a well-made product.

What are common applications for premium fabric hot stamping foil?

You will see this foil on garment labels, brand logos on t-shirts and hoodies, decorative motifs on evening wear, heat-transferred patterns on denim, home textile accents like cushion covers and curtains, and even technical apparel trim. It is favored where a sharp metallic edge or luxury sheen is needed.
